ci.dose.radir: Credible intervals for radiation dose

Description

The function allows the user to compute credible intervals for radiation doses objects of class radir.

Usage

ci.dose.radir(object, cr=0.95)

Arguments

object

the doses estimated by dose.distr function, an object of class radir.

cr

size of the credibility region. Its default value is 0.95.

Value

A vector with two elements containing the lower and upper bounds of the credible region.
